    Legacy of Kain : Soul Reaver 2

    ''Reedemer. Destroyer. Pawn. Messiah.''

    I wanted to play SR1 first but alas - Thy game doth not work...

    SR2 is simply awe-inspiring in many ways: The story, an excellent one at that, It talks about the story of Raziel, a vampire-turned-wraith. As far as I know from playin the start of SR1, Kain threw him into the Lake of the Dead, thus forcing Raziel to endure 1000 years of unspeakable pain. A creature called the Elder God ressurected him, and due to his transformation to a Vampire-Wraith, he is forced to thrive on souls.

    Then there's the combat system : It functions similarly to the BO2's CS, but is far more dynamic than it's predecessor. It allows Raziel to impale, decapitate, execute heavy attacks and such forth. Awesome design, Crystal Dynamics!

    There's alot more to that, but that would be just simple spoiling, now wouldn't it?

    I finally started playing Amnesia, after it stayed pretty high on my to play list ever since its release. I had quite some expectations from it after playing Penumbra, and, simply put, it was excelent, more than I could have asked. I have played other horror games before (The Suffering, Nosferatu), but they came nowhere near Amnesia. This might have something to do with the fact that I chose to do a text book playthrough, so to speak: no lights except for that made by my laptop, headphones, absolutely no one in close proximity and always after 11 or 12 in the night.

    The result was pretty much the scariest video gaming experience I have ever had. The way in which the sound effects, the graphics and your characters reactions mix is brilliant. I almost wet my pants after the first two minutes when a door suddenly opens in front of me and the char begins to shiver and breathe heavily.

    The story - and the way it is being told for that matter - is also great. Very ambigous in the beginning, the plot starts to build as you make progress and you discover pieces of writing from journals or have some sort of semi-flashbacks.
    In conclusion, a definite keeper.
